Company Employee Transitions to Business Owner

What are people, with little prospects of becoming wealthy by working for other people, doing to earn more money? Transitioning from employee to business owner is often the most daunting leap to make. However once this is done, following a Plan maximizes opportunity for success.

Sydney, Australia (PRWEB) October 22, 2006 -- One of the most basic assumptions of economics is that people know what they want. The more people learn about what they want, the more they realize that it usually takes more money then they are earning.

So what are people, with little prospects of becoming wealthy by working for other people, doing to earn more money and create wealth?

Sandor Panton is one example of someone who 'defies the company stereotype' and has successfully transitioned from company employee to business owner. Panton is a young entrepreneur based in Jamaica and owner of the successful website business, top5jamaica.com, a marketing site which he started as part of a university project. The site currently attracts around 250,000 unique visitors per month.

After completing his degree, Panton found employment with a small company in Canada responsible for marketing and advertising online. He realized he could be starting his own business and so set about developing his business ideas. Panton decided he needed to have a secure income stream while he was starting his own company and so he negotiated with his employer for part-time work as a remote consultant.

Sean Conway, Managing Director, The Millionaire's Plan says "This is the innovative thinking that allows people to break away from employers, start their own business whilst still generating an income to support living costs.

If people are willing to take a reduction in income to start their own business, they can actually start to grow their business in a relatively stable environment."
